Mediation
A form of alternative dispute resolution where a neutral third party helps disputing parties find a mutually acceptable solution.
Dispute Resolution
A process through which disagreements or conflicts are resolved, often involving negotiation, mediation, arbitration, or litigation.
Parties
Individuals or entities that enter into a legal agreement or are engaged in a lawsuit.
Question of Fact
involves issues that are resolved by examining the evidence and determining the truth or falsehood of disputed facts during a trial.
